Strategy for transitioning existing ServiceDesk to another server and drive location.

Is this a valid strategy for transitioning ServiceDesk to a new physical server with minimal downtime?



Strategy:  Changing from on physical server to another.  Install path is on different drive.  ServiceDesk version is the same on both servers.  No upgrades occurring.

  1. HelpDesk is primary linked to a remote SQL server using the ServiceDesk database.
  1. HelpDesk2 is the new server.  Both servers are the same OS.
  2. During the day, install the same version of ServiceDesk onto HelpDesk2.  It is ok to install it on a different drive.  Use the local database during the install.
  3. While HelpDesk is still online and in use, point the Helpdesk2 install to the ServiceDesk database.  Both servers should now see the same information (except for attachments).  NOTE:  No one will enter any information into CCIHelpdesk2 until after go live.
  1. Using a file sync utility or RoboCopy, copy the 4 necessary directories to the HelpDesk2 server.  These should be synced at the time of transition.
  1. At implementation time, shut down the ServiceDesk services on HelpDesk.  Make sure that the 4 directories are synced to the new server.
  1. Rename the HelpDesk server to HelpDesk_Old, and change the IP Address.
  1. Rename the HelpDesk2 server to HelpDesk and change the IP to the original value.
